The 6122EL butterfly valve is a crucial component widely used in various industries for controlling fluid flow. As a type of quarter-turn valve, it operates by rotating a circular disc, known as the butterfly, which allows or restricts fluid passage through the pipeline. This design not only enhances efficiency but also provides operators with quick and reliable control over the flow.
Installation and maintenance of the 6122EL butterfly valve are relatively straightforward, making it a popular choice among engineers and operators. Its compact design allows for easy integration into existing piping systems, saving valuable space. Moreover, the simple mechanism minimizes the need for extensive maintenance, thus reducing operational costs over time.
Another advantage of the 6122EL butterfly valve is its versatility. It is compatible with a wide range of fluids, including water, slurries, and gases, making it suitable for various applications. Whether used in a cooling system or a wastewater treatment plant, the adaptability of this valve ensures optimal performance across multiple environments.
